docker搭建图片鉴别nsfw

175 阅读1分钟

1.检测在线图片

#如需要公开访问,请去掉`127.0.0.1:
docker run -d -p 127.0.0.1:5000:5000/tcp \ 
--env PORT=5000 \
--restart=always \ 
eugencepoi/nsfw_api:latest

#测试方法
curl -X GET -H 'Content-Type: application/json' "http://127.0.0.1:5000?url=图片地址"

#response
{ "score": 分数, "url": "图片地址" }

2.上传图片之前进行鉴别

services:
  nsfw-api:
    image: penndu/nsfw-api:latest
    restart: unless-stopped
    hostname: nsfw-api
    container_name: nsfw-api
    ports:
      - "14727:3000"